Easy Fiesta Chicken Casserole Recipe

Ingredients

Scale

Main Ingredients:

  • 2 cups shredded cooked chicken (rotisserie chicken works great!)
  • 1 cup uncooked white or brown rice
  • 1 ½ cups chicken broth
  • 1 can (15 oz) black beans, drained and rinsed
  • 1 can (15 oz) corn, drained
  • 1 can (10 oz) diced tomatoes with green chilies (Rotel recommended)
  • 1 cup sour cream
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1 cup shredded Monterey Jack cheese
  • ½ cup cream cheese, softened
  • 1 teaspoon chili powder
  • 1 teaspoon cumin
  • ½ teaspoon garlic powder
  • ½ teaspoon onion powder
  • ½ teaspoon smoked paprika
  • Salt and black pepper to taste
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• ½ cup chopped green onions (for garnish)
  • ¼ cup chopped fresh cilantro (optional)

Optional Additions & Substitutions:

  • Substitute rice with cauliflower rice for a low-carb version.
  • Add diced jalapeños for extra heat.
  • Use Greek yogurt instead of sour cream for a lighter version.
  • Swap black beans for pinto beans if preferred.

Instructions

Step 1: Preheat and Prep

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Grease a 9×13-inch baking dish with cooking spray or a light coat of olive oil.

Step 2: Cook the Rice

In a medium saucepan, cook the rice according to package instructions using chicken broth instead of water. This adds extra flavor!

Step 3: Mix the Ingredients

In a large mixing bowl, combine:

  • Shredded cooked chicken
  • Cooked rice
  • Black beans, corn, and diced tomatoes
  • Sour cream and cream cheese
  • Spices (chili powder, cumin, garlic powder, onion powder, smoked paprika, salt, and pepper)

Stir everything together until fully mixed.

Step 4: Assemble the Casserole

  • Spread half of the mixture into the prepared baking dish.
  • Sprinkle half of the shredded cheeses over the layer.
  • Add the remaining casserole mixture.
  • Top with the rest of the cheddar and Monterey Jack cheese.

Step 5: Bake the Casserole

Cover the dish with foil and bake for 25 minutes. Remove the foil and bake for another 10-15 minutes until the cheese is melted and bubbly.

Step 6: Garnish and Serve

Once done, let the casserole rest for 5 minutes before serving. Garnish with chopped green onions and fresh cilantro.

Notes

  • Use pre-cooked chicken like rotisserie chicken to save time.
  • Make it spicy by adding crushed red pepper flakes or hot sauce.
  • Prepare ahead by assembling the casserole in the morning and baking it later.
